@media screen and (min-width: 1100px) {
.slot--header-horizontal-menu {
min-height: 50px;
}
.bountiful--body {
min-height: 100vh;
}
.bountiful--header-right {
min-height: 58px;
}
}
table {
  width: 100%;
  border-collapse: collapse;
}

th, td {
  border: 1px solid black;
  padding: 8px;
  text-align: left;
}

th {
  background-color: lightpink;
}

/*Speed*/
@media screen and (max-width: 1100px) {

/* .bountiful--top-bar-wrapper.clearfix {
    min-height: 104px;
}*/
  .slot--header-horizontal-menu {
min-height: 50px;
}
.bountiful--body {
min-height: 100vh;
}
.bountiful--header-right {
min-height: 58px;
}
}

.tws-accept-cookies--modal .modal-footer #consentAcceptButton {
  background: #6ab04c;
  color: #fff;
}


.articlegroup-4135235 .tws-article-filter--filter-control-container.above-list {
    display: none;
}

html[lang="sv"] .checkout .tws-checkout---newsletter .tws-checkout--field-label-text {
    font-size: 0;
}

html[lang="sv"] .checkout .tws-checkout---newsletter .tws-checkout--field-label-text:after {
    content: "Ja tack! Jag önskar ta del av rabatter och erbjudanden via nyhetsbrev från MedicOnline.";
    font-size: 13px;
    color: black;
    display: inline-block; 
}

html[lang="sv"] .checkout .tws-checkout---newsletter .tws-checkout--field-label-text:before {
    display: inline-block; 
}
.articlegroup-1096945 .tws-article-filter--filter-control-container.above-list {
    display: none;
}
.articlegroup-1690072 .tws-article-filter--filter-control-container.above-list {
    display: none;
}
.articlegroup-1096945 .open-filter-button {
  display:none;
}
.articlegroup-1690072 .open-filter-button {
  display:none;
}

.articlegroup-4561252 .tws-article-filter--filter-control-container.above-list {
  display: none;
}
.articlegroup-4561252 .open-filter-button {
  display:none;
}
.articlegroup-5533877 .tws-article-filter--filter-control-container.above-list {
  display: none;
}
.articlegroup-5533877 .open-filter-button {
  display:none;
}
.articlegroup-1666178 .tws-article-filter--filter-control-container.above-list {
  display: none;
}
.articlegroup-1666178 .open-filter-button {
  display:none;
}
.articlegroup-5558605 .tws-article-filter--filter-control-container.above-list {
  display: none;
}
.articlegroup-5558605 .open-filter-button {
  display:none;
}
.articlegroup-1688397 .tws-article-filter--filter-control-container.above-list {
  display: none;
}
.articlegroup-1688397 .open-filter-button {
  display:none;
}
.articlegroup-5922951 .tws-article-filter--filter-control-container.above-list {
  display: none;
}
.articlegroup-5922951 .open-filter-button {
  display:none;
}
.articlegroup-3891921 .tws-article-filter--filter-control-container.above-list {
  display: none;
}
.articlegroup-3891921 .open-filter-button {
  display:none;
}
.articlegroup-5930487 .tws-article-filter--filter-control-container.above-list {
  display: none;
}
.articlegroup-5930487 .open-filter-button {
  display:none;
}
.articlegroup-5930491 .tws-article-filter--filter-control-container.above-list {
  display: none;
}
.articlegroup-5930491 .open-filter-button {
  display:none;
}
.articlegroup-5930577 .tws-article-filter--filter-control-container.above-list {
  display: none;
}
.articlegroup-5930577 .open-filter-button {
  display:none;
}
.articlegroup-2176565 .tws-article-filter--filter-control-container.above-list {
  display: none;
}
.articlegroup-2176565 .open-filter-button {
  display:none;
}
.articlegroup-1139521 .tws-article-filter--filter-control-container.above-list {
  display: none;
}
.articlegroup-1139521 .open-filter-button {
  display:none;
}
.articlegroup-1911049 .tws-article-filter--filter-control-container.above-list {
  display: none;
}
.articlegroup-1911049 .open-filter-button {
  display:none;
}
.articlegroup-1917840 .tws-article-filter--filter-control-container.above-list {
  display: none;
}
.articlegroup-1917840 .open-filter-button {
  display:none;
}

.articlegroup-1710750 .tws-article-filter--filter-control-container.above-list {
  display: none;
}
.articlegroup-1710750 .open-filter-button {
  display:none;
}.articlegroup-1096945 .tws-article-filter--filter-control-container.above-list {
  display: none;
}

.bountiful--main-wrapper {
  min-height: 1800px;
}

.modal .modal-dialog .modal-content .modal-footer .btn+.btn {
background: #0bda51;
}

.slot--article-share {
display: none;
}
.custompage-8955445 .tws-article-filter--filter-control-container.above-list,
.custompage-8950903 .tws-article-filter--filter-control-container.above-list,
.custompage-8994005 .tws-article-filter--filter-control-container.above-list,
.custompage-8993989 .tws-article-filter--filter-control-container.above-list,
.custompage-8959511 .tws-article-filter--filter-control-container.above-list {
     display: none !important;
}
/* Default (Swedish) */ 

[lang="sv"] .tws-checkout--select-delivery-list-empty::before { 
content: "Ange ditt postnummer för att se vilka ombud vi kan leverera ditt paket till."; 
font-size: 14px; 
font-weight: 600; 
} 

/* English */ 

[lang="en"] .tws-checkout--select-delivery-list-empty::before { 
content: "Enter your postal code to see which delivery agents we can send your package to."; 
font-size: 14px; 
font-weight: 600; 
} 

/* Finnish */ 

[lang="fi"] .tws-checkout--select-delivery-list-empty::before { 

content: "Anna postinumerosi nähdäksesi, mihin toimituspisteisiin voimme lähettää pakettisi."; 
font-size: 14px; 
font-weight: 600; 
} 

/* Hide the default empty message */ 

.tws-checkout--select-delivery-list-empty { 
font-size: 0px; 
}
